72 Chaplin Hill Ln is a Single Family built in 2013 located in Naples, Cumberland County, ME. The home has 1,036 square feet of living area on a 3.25-acre lot.
72 Chaplin Hill Ln is in FEMA flood zone X. Zone X is outside the Special Flood Hazard Area, meaning the property has minimal flood risk according to FEMA mapping. The FEMA National Risk Index composite rating for this area is Very Low. The ASCE 7-22 design wind speed for this location is 112 mph. The ground snow load is 90 psf. The EPA radon zone is 2.
NE Provenance rates the fire protection for 72 Chaplin Hill Ln at Grade E (Minimal fire protection access). The nearest fire station, Naples Fire and Rescue Department, is 3.4 miles away. This grade reflects fire station proximity, department capabilities, hydrant coverage, and municipal water infrastructure. Properties with Grade D or E may face higher insurance premiums due to limited fire protection resources.
The current municipal assessment is $520,201, with $139,125 attributed to land and $381,076 to improvements. The property last sold on February 10, 2025 for $630,000.
72 Chaplin Hill Ln is located in Naples, Cumberland County, ME. The median home value in this census tract is $259,300. Median household income is $61,385. The owner-occupancy rate in the surrounding area is 85%. The property is served by the School Administrative District 61 school district.
